Over half of the residents in Black Hill are older adults aged between 45 and 64. This sparsely populated area is far older than the national average, with a typical resident aged 55. It is a small community of just 45 people.

How the population splits across age groups.
Children under 15 make up only 6.7% of the population, a figure far below the national level. Meanwhile, one in five residents is a senior aged 65 or over, which is about the same as the state average.

First Nations identity and marital status.
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people make up 6.7% of the population, which is well above the national figure. Those in de facto relationships account for 28.2% of residents, a rate far above that of South Australia.
